阿里云国际站:AST语法树 JS 与服务器安全防护的应用
引言:服务器安全的重要性
随着互联网的发展,网络安全问题逐渐成为了企业和用户面临的一个重大挑战。尤其是在云计算时代,服务器的安全防护已经变得至关重要。不同于传统的本地服务器,云服务器面临着更多的攻击风险,包括但不限于分布式拒绝服务攻击(DDoS)、数据泄露、恶意代码注入等。因此,部署有效的防火墙、应用防护以及流量管理策略是确保服务器安全的关键所在。
阿里云国际站的安全防护技术
阿里云作为全球领先的云计算平台,提供了多种安全防护解决方案,旨在保护用户的服务器和应用免受各种网络攻击。通过结合先进的防火墙技术、waf(Web应用防火墙)、DDoS防护和智能流量管理,阿里云能够为客户提供全方位的安全防护服务。其中,AST语法树(Abstract Syntax Tree)在安全检测中的应用,尤为重要。
AST语法树及其在JS中的应用
AST(抽象语法树)是一种将源代码转换为树状结构的数据形式,它表示了程序语法的结构。JavaScript代码中的AST,可以通过分析代码的结构来识别潜在的安全问题和恶意代码。通过解析AST,安全防护系统能够更精确地检测到潜在的XSS(跨站脚本攻击)和SQL注入等攻击模式。
在阿里云的Web应用防护(WAF)中,AST语法树被广泛应用于JavaScript代码的安全检测。它可以有效地识别恶意脚本、恶意请求等问题,防止恶意攻击通过网站的输入接口注入恶意代码。通过AST分析,WAF能够实时发现并阻止攻击,从而大大增强了Web应用的安全性。
DDoS防护:防御大规模攻击的关键
分布式拒绝服务攻击(DDoS)是当前最常见的网络攻击之一,攻击者通过向目标服务器发送大量无效请求,使服务器资源耗尽,导致正常用户无法访问。在这种情况下,传统的防火墙技术往往无法有效防止DDoS攻击。
阿里云的DDoS防护解决方案基于智能流量清洗技术,能够自动检测并过滤掉恶意流量。通过分布式部署的防火墙节点,DDoS防护系统能够实时识别异常流量,并将其引流至清洗池,过滤掉垃圾流量,确保服务器资源的正常运行。尤其是通过结合AI技术,阿里云的DDoS防护能够更加精准地识别攻击源,减少误报与漏报。
Web应用防火墙(WAF):保护网站免受复杂攻击
WAF(Web应用防火墙)是一种专门用于保护Web应用免受常见攻击的安全防护工具。WAF通过分析HTTP请求和响应的内容,识别并拦截恶意请求,防止攻击者通过注入恶意代码、SQL注入等手段入侵Web应用。
在阿里云的WAF防火墙中,AST语法树分析技术得到了广泛应用。通过对HTTP请求中的JavaScript和其他Web相关内容进行深度解析,WAF能够识别攻击行为,并实时拦截不合法的请求。此外,阿里云的WAF防火墙还具备自学习能力,能够通过不断积累攻击特征,提升对新型攻击的防御能力。
综合解决方案:高效的服务器安全防护
阿里云为用户提供了全面的安全防护解决方案,其中包括DDoS防护、WAF防火墙、以及基于AST语法树的恶意代码检测。通过将这些技术有机结合,阿里云能够实现对服务器及Web应用的全方位保护。
例如,当WAF检测到恶意请求时,它会立即拦截该请求,并通过AST语法树技术分析该请求中的代码内容,判断是否存在恶意脚本或SQL注入攻击。同时,阿里云的DDoS防护系统则能有效分担服务器的流量负担,防止DDoS攻击导致的服务中断。最终,用户的Web应用和服务器能够得到全面保护,确保业务的持续稳定运行。
总结:全方位的安全防护是保障服务器安全的关键
通过结合DDoS防护、WAF防火墙、AST语法树分析技术等多重防护手段,阿里云为用户提供了一套强大的服务器安全防护方案。这些技术不仅能够有效识别并阻止各种攻击,还能够通过自我学习和智能分析提高防护能力。无论是面对大规模的DDoS攻击,还是复杂的Web应用漏洞,阿里云都能够为用户提供可靠的解决方案,确保服务器安全运行。
总的来说,随着网络安全形势的日益复杂,阿里云通过引入先进的安全技术,如AST语法树分析,保障了服务器和应用的安全性。企业和开发者应当充分利用这些安全防护工具,确保其网站和服务能够应对未来的各种安全挑战。